    Overall the story  quite funny which is a big plus for me especially since most works are laced with too much tragedy. You won't be disappointed, a few chapters in and you'll see thats it quite an easy read.
    Style - The author prefers to use script style writing which makes it easier for you to distinguish who talks and whatnot. He still has to come up with his own unique writing but he's off to a good start.
    Story - The story has promise, don't let the prologue fool you, you might think his world building is a bit cliched but it was executed out nicely in a brief yet comedic way.
    Grammar - There are still lots of points to improve, like correct usage of a/an/the articles, usage of pronouns and such. I gave it a 4.5 because he still has a lot to improve but the mistakes can be overlooked at for now.
    Character - Characterization is fine, not too many details at once but enough to make you recognize each person. Give it time and we'll see what happens.
    I recommend this to anyone looking for a nice comedic story. This one would be easy to read and you'll run out of chapters before you even notice it.
